Transaction 5b94aa41217c000cda84f7b806014776583aa4e344c9770629a643ddd550da75
1 Input
1 Output
-
5b94aa41217c000cda84f7b806014776583aa4e344c9770629a643ddd550da75:0
- value
- 339785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 21fb60b355ed84ed7bd47de1630d9e818154d3ac OP_EQUAL
- address
- 34nhMuUJqDhu18mRWxk5LNP2Dm1FTqomgc